January in Chamarel, Mauritius is characterized by warm temperatures and considerable humidity, creating a tropical paradise. The maximum temperature reaches a pleasant 30°C (86°F), while the average settles at a comfortable 26°C (79°F), with a minimum of 22°C (71°F). Rainfall is notable, with a total of 154 mm (6.0 in) spread across 21 rainy days, contributing to the lush landscapes. Humidity levels soar to 82%, enhancing the tropical ambiance. January in Chamarel, Mauritius, is characterized by a considerable precipitation total of 154 mm (6.0 in), marking the start of the wet season. With 21 rainy days, it’s not uncommon to encounter frequent showers, setting the stage for lush, vibrant landscapes. As the month progresses into February and March, rainfall increases, peaking at 176 mm (6.9 in) for both months, with the number of rainy days also rising to 24 and 25, respectively. This trend highlights a consistent moist environment, crucial for the region's stunning flora. Moving into April, precipitation begins to taper off to 134 mm (5.3 in), yet the residual humidity continues to nourish the lush greenery. In January, Chamarel, Mauritius experiences a high humidity level of 82%, characteristic of its tropical climate. This pattern seems to lay the groundwork for the following month, as February's humidity rises to 86%, making it the most humid month of the year. Upon entering March, humidity levels settle back to 82%, resembling January's conditions, which marks a trend of slight fluctuations throughout the early months. By April, humidity stabilizes at 83%, before gradually tapering down to a more comfortable 80% in May. The transition into winter months shows a notable decrease, with June and August dipping to 74%, while September sees a mild uptick to 78%. In January, Chamarel, Mauritius experiences a dramatic UV Index of 16, categorized as extreme, which means that even brief exposure can lead to sunburn in just 10 minutes. This intensity continues into February, maintaining the same index and burn time, emphasizing the region's relentless tropical sun. As summer progresses into March, the UV Index slightly decreases to 14, yet it remains in the extreme category, ensuring that sun safety remains a priority. The trend begins to shift in April with a UV Index of 12, still deemed extreme, followed by a gradual decline into the months of May through July, where values range from very high to high. By August, the index nudges back up slightly before surging again in the latter part of the year, with November and December both hitting significant levels of 14 and 15 respectively. In Chamarel, Mauritius, the winds of January usher in a gentle breeze, with an average wind speed of 5.5 m/s (12 mph), mirroring the calm of February. As the year progresses, a noticeable shift occurs; winds pick up momentum, reaching 6.9 m/s (16 mph) in June and peaking at 8.0 m/s (18 mph) in July. This uptick hints at a seasonal pattern where the mid-year months foster stronger gusts, before tapering off again into the more tranquil conditions of late autumn and winter. By December, the winds ease to a cozy 5.3 m/s (12 mph), wrapping up the year with a reminder of the island's serene charm.
